McCaskey gets first look at camp

PLATTEVILLE, Wis. Former Bears president Michael McCaskey arrivedin town for the first time since being bumped up to chairman of theboard of directors.

"I'm enjoying it more," McCaskey said of his new job. "There'sless attention paid to day-to-day stuff and more attention paid tolong-term stuff."

McCaskey said he is not insulted that the relationship between themayor's office and new president Ted Phillips has yieldedsignificantly more progress on the new stadium than under hisleadership.

"It's just a question of timing," McCaskey said. "I don't thinkthe city was ready to talk earlier. Now they are."
